The peloton leaves Cahors with 211-kilometres in front of them...

Sandy Casar has crashed into a dog while escaping in the opening kilometres - he's looking back at Axel Merckx, who is chasing across...

Michael Boogerd and Laurent Lefevre are waiting for Casar - and for Merckx..!

Axel Merckx now leads the escape to a five-minute lead in 30-kilometres...

The peloton settles down to enjoy the scenery alongside the Dordogne River...

Alberto Contador cannot complain about the pressure today...it's so easy!

Boogerd and Merckx must be thinking of a nice retirement gift - a stage-win in Angouleme..!

There's no doubt about it - Discovery Channel is in charge of this Tour de France – even though the escape is 17 minutes up the road...

Boogerd needs a wheel-change - knowing his mates will wait for him...

Boogerd leads the quartet to within 10-kilometres of the finish...

Sandy Casar wins stage eighteen into Angouléme - it is France's second stage-win of this Tour...
